Notes

Scored four runs in the bottom of the fifth inning to erase a 6-4 deficit in 8-6 win over South Vineland... Had an 8-3 lead in the third inning over eventual World Series champion West University, but couldn’t hold on, losing 9-8. The pitching staff hit five West University batters. Had West Madison National won the game, the last in the series’ pool play, West Madison would have won the head-to-head tiebreaker over West University and South Vineland to advance to the semifinals...Zach Addamo hit a two-run home run over West University... Chris Anderson hit a grand slam over Friuli Venezia Giulia... The pitching staff’s ERA was 7.00... Of the 37 hits the pitching staff allowed in 26 innings, 11 were for extra bases... The pitching staff walked 22 batters while striking out 20... Opponents hit .339...
